Training for back in training was not in line with new *** guide lines
In August I took a road test for my Class A license that I was never properly trained for, after coming out of the Transport Training Center. During my 4 weeks in the truck I was never informed by the instructors of changes to the back in that would take effect on July 1st. Because of these changes made to the 90 degree back in maneuver - I was never prepared for the road test and was never able to practice a tight alley back in as laid out as a requirement for the road test by *** and ***. *** says that they work closely with both *** and ***, but they completely failed to notify students of these changes prior to July 1st but test after - for when these changes take effect.

The diagram that shows the space given for a 90 degree road test that should have been available to the *** prior to July 1st shows a maximum apron space of 110ft, much less than I was ever trained for. Moreover, with my time in the truck I was only tasked to back in to two different 90 degree back ins, the *** parking area and the intersection of *** and ***, neither of which properly simulate a tight alley back in with minimal pull ahead like the one on the test. *** also informed me that the *** regularly takes students to the space where the back in is performed and they have no issue with that, so it is puzzling to myself, why I was never given the opportunity to practice in the space during my course time.

Because of these circumstances that I have detailed, I am requesting a full refund for the amount that I have paid for training from the school. I will not be able to pursue a career in trucking because of all the lost time I have endured due to receiving inadequate training from this institution.

The *** has reached out to me to offer a pittance 2 free hours of training, compared to the 260hrs of training that I received over 6 weeks. They are doing nothing to rectify the lost time for the entire 6 weeks of class time/on the road training where I was given wrong information by their instructors. Or the cost of the road test that I was setup for failure for.

Transport Training Centres Of Canada Response

Initial Business Response /(1000, 5, 2017/09/26) */
The complainant successfully completed and passed our 6 week *** on June 30th 2017. This course provides the necessary training to pass the *** road test at ***. We are not allowed to guarantee that the candidate will pass the *** but we offer the next best thing which is unlimited use of our truck and trainer for any additional road test should one be required at no charge (a $500 value for any additional attempt). A certificate was issued to him on July 10th. Proof of his completion of the *** was also uploaded to the ***.

We provided a truck for him to use for the road test on July 7th. He successfully passed the Z endorsement portion of the test and did receive that endorsement on his ***. He stated that he did not feel comfortable with backing a particular way so we offered 2 free hours of additional training specific to his concern and unlimited use of our truck for any further road tests.

On September 6th 2017 the complainant communicated to us via email (***) that he no longer wished to pursue his *** license, and that he did not want to take advantage of our offer of free training because he has found employment elsewhere. We feel that we have gone above and beyond of what was expected of us and have earned our tuition.
